Best Summer Tourist Places in India

                                                 India is a diverse country with many unique and beautiful tourist destinations to visit during the summer. Here are some of the best summer tourist places in India:

  1. Ladakh: Ladakh, a high-altitude desert in the northernmost region of India, is a popular summer destination for adventure lovers. The region is known for its stunning landscapes, including snow-capped mountains, turquoise lakes, and Buddhist monasteries. Visitors can enjoy trekking, mountain biking, and white-water rafting.

  2. Kashmir: Kashmir, also known as "Paradise on Earth," is a stunning region in northern India. The valley is surrounded by majestic snow-capped mountains and dotted with beautiful gardens, lakes, and waterfalls. Visitors can enjoy boating on the Dal Lake, trekking in the mountains, and exploring the local markets.

  3. Darjeeling: Darjeeling, located in the Himalayan foothills of West Bengal, is a popular summer destination for its tea gardens, scenic views, and cool climate. Visitors can enjoy a ride on the famous Darjeeling Himalayan Railway, hike Tiger Hill to see the sunrise over the mountains and visit the Buddhist monasteries.

  4. Goa: Goa, located on the western coast of India, is known for its beautiful beaches, nightlife, and Portuguese colonial architecture. Visitors can relax on the beaches, try water sports, and explore historic landmarks.

  5. Ooty: Ooty, located in the Nilgiri Hills of Tamil Nadu, is a popular summer destination for its cool climate and stunning landscapes. Visitors can take a ride on the Nilgiri Mountain Railway, stroll through the botanical gardens, and visit the local tea plantations.

  6. Manali: Manali, located in the state of Himachal Pradesh, is a popular summer destination for its scenic views and adventure activities. Visitors can go trekking in the mountains, enjoy paragliding and other adventure sports, and visit the nearby Rohtang Pass for stunning views of the Himalayas.

  7. Coorg: Coorg, located in the western Ghats of Karnataka, is known for its coffee plantations, waterfalls, and lush green forests. Visitors can go on a plantation tour, trek to the nearby mountains, and visit the local wildlife sanctuary.
